    All Node.js versions

    All Node.js versions

    List all available Node.js versions

    List all available Node.js versions. Sorted from the most to the least recent. Includes major release and LTS information. This package is an ES module and must be loaded using an import or import() statement, not require(). The return value resolves to an object with the following properties. List of available Node.js versions and related information. Sorted from the most to the least recent Node.js version. List of Node.js major releases sorted from the most to the least recent.

    isomorphic-git

    isomorphic-git

    A pure JavaScript implementation of git for node and browsers!

    A pure JavaScript implementation of git for node and browsers! Clone repos, create commits, push branches and more in client-side JS. It uses the same on-disk format as git so it works with existing repos. isomorphic-git is a pure JavaScript implementation of git that works in node and browser environments (including WebWorkers and ServiceWorkers). This means it can be used to read and write to git repositories, as well as fetch from and push to git remotes like GitHub. isomorphic-git aims for 100% interoperability with the canonical git implementation. ...
